Creator's Key Takeaways

there's an unhealthy obsession with cheap cheap rather than an obsession with quality

Laura has put sort of the customer right as our North Star in the business

we're going on a cruise and we're going to try and experience it as a customer

technology is good but it could be way way better

Creator's Tips & Advice

Travel agents should focus on selling quality and matching the right cruise to the customer rather than competing on price
Agents should experience the product personally to better communicate its value to clients
